#62889f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#62889f is composed of 38.4% red, 53.3%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.4% cyan, 14.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 202.6 degrees, a saturation of 24.1% and a lightness of 50.4%. #62889f color hex could be obtained by blending #c4ffff with #00113f.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

Shades and Tints of #62889f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f4f7f8 is the lightest one.
